U-bolt Usage: Mainly used for water pipes and other fixed pipe fittings or plates. Key applications include the construction and installation of automotive steel plate springs, mechanical connections, vehicles, ships, bridges, tunnels, and railways.

Application Areas: U-bolts are frequently used in trucks to stabilize car chassis and frames; for instance, leaf springs are typically connected by U-bolts. Their versatility extends to mechanical component connections across various modern industrial sectors.
Furthermore, U-bolts are valued for being easy to install, maintain, and replace. They offer excellent seismic performance and anti-loosening functions. When selecting U-bolts, critical factors include material, density, strength, and compressive requirements to ensure durability in specific environments.
